Yetenekler Araması: Gerçek Hayat Senaryoları
127 doküman. Komutlar, yetenekler, kişisel notlar. İhtiyacım olanı nasıl buluyorum.
Senaryo 1: “Prime Number” — Anahtar Kelimeyle Buldum
Asal sayı mimarisi hakkında teorik bir notum vardı. Tam dosya adını hatırlamıyorum. Asal sayılarla ilgili bir şey.
Skills panelini açıyorum. prime yazıyorum.
Anahtar kelime ve açıklamalarda arıyor — anında. prime-number komutum çıkıyor. Sağda önizlemeyi görüyorum: tam içerik.

Claude Code’da /prime-number yazardım — ama tam ismi bilmem lazımdı. Burada hatırladığımı yazıyorum. O buluyor.
Senaryo 2: Başlıklarda “Design” — Yapısal Arama
Dokümanlarımın birinde “design” başlıklı bir bölüm olduğunu biliyorum. Dosya adında değil, anahtar kelimelerde değil — markdown başlığında.
##design yazıyorum.

Sadece ## başlıkları aranıyor. Gövde değil, anahtar kelimeler değil — sadece yapı. Tam metin aramasından hızlı, anahtar kelimeden hassas.
"prime" → anahtar kelime + açıklama (hızlı, geniş)
"##design" → sadece başlıklar (hızlı, yapısal)
İki farklı derinlik. Aynı panel.
Senaryo 3: Gövdede “Exhaustive” — Derin Arama
Bir dokümanın derinliklerinde “exhaustive” yazdığımı biliyorum. Başlıkta değil, anahtar kelimelerde değil, bir başlıkta değil — gövde metninin bir yerinde.
^exhaustive yazıyorum.
^ öneki tam gövde taraması tetikliyor. Her dokümanın her satırını okuyor. Daha yavaş ama buluyor.
"prime" → anahtar kelime + açıklama (anında)
"##design" → sadece başlıklar (anında)
"^exhaustive" → tam gövde metni (yavaş, kapsamlı)
Üç derinlik. Bildiklerine göre seçiyorsun:
- Anahtar kelimeyi biliyorsan? Sadece yaz.
- Bölüm başlığını biliyorsan?
##kullan. - Bir yerlerde gömülü olduğunu biliyorsan?
^kullan.
Senaryo 4: optionOS Trading Komutları — Üçlü Filtre
optionOS projemden trading ile ilgili komutlara ihtiyacım var. Skill değil, doküman değil — komut. Başka projelerden değil — optionOS’tan.
/c #trading $opus yazıyorum.
/c → sadece bash komutları (slash command değil, text değil)
#trading → "trading" anahtar kelimesiyle
$opus → sadece opus modeli
Üç filtre, tek satır. Tek sonuç.
Senaryo 5: Konuşuyordum — “Architecture” Belirdi
Dikte ile kayıt yapıyorum. Yeni bir özellik hakkında konuşuyorum. “…mimari tasarım kalıbını takip etmemiz lazım…” diyorum.
Altta bir popup beliriyor. architectural-design komutum. Aramadım.
KONUŞMAM NE OLDU
──────── ───────
"...mimari tasarım..." → "architectural" eşleşti
→ "design" eşleşti
→ architectural-design.md önerildi
Her dokümanın frontmatter’ında anahtar kelimeleri var. Dikte konuşmamdan kelimeleri çıkarıyor. Eşleştiğinde — doküman yüzeye çıkıyor.
Tıklıyorum. Önizleme açılıyor. İçeriği görüyorum, doğru bölümü buluyorum, kopyalıyorum. AI’a yapıştırıyorum. AI’ın tam olarak ihtiyacı olan bağlam elinde.
Dosya adını hatırlamadım. Skills panelini açmadım. Sadece konuştum. Doğru doküman bana geldi.
Senaryo 6: 3 Skill, Toplu Kopyalama, Tek AI Oturumu
AI’a karmaşık bir brief vereceğim. İhtiyacı olan:
- Mimari prensiplerimi
- Swift pattern dokümanımı
- Veritabanı tasarım notlarımı
Skills panelini açıyorum. İlkini buluyorum — Shift+tıkla. İkincisini — Shift+tıkla. Üçüncüsünü — Shift+tıkla.
Üç doküman seçili. Toplam bağlam görünür.
⌘C. AI’a yapıştır. Üçü birden, sırasıyla, tek aksiyonda.
Claude Code’da /architecture yazardım, bekle, /swift-patterns yaz, bekle, /database-design yaz, bekle. Üç ayrı enjeksiyon. AI’a vermeden önce birlikte görme imkanı yok.
Burada: üç önizlemeyi gör, doğru olanlar mı doğrula, bir kere kopyala, bir kere yapıştır. Orkestrayı sen yapıyorsun.
Arama Dili — Tam Referans
3 doküman türü:
/s → slash command'lar
/c → bash komutları
/t → text dokümanlar
4 arama derinliği — her biri daha derine gider:
prime → anahtar kelime + açıklama (hızlı, varsayılan)
#prime → sadece anahtar kelime (frontmatter.keywords'te tam eşleşme)
##design → sadece markdown başlıkları (yapısal)
^exhaustive → tam gövde metni (yavaş, bilinçli — diğerleri başarısız olunca kullan)
Filtreler:
@Bash → Bash tool kullanan
@/path → belirli yol/namespace'ten
>1k → büyük dokümanlar (1000+ karakter)
<500 → küçük dokümanlar
~w → bu hafta değişen
İstediğini birleştir:
/c #trading $opus → "trading" anahtar kelimeli bash komutları, opus modeli
/s @Bash ~w → Bash kullanan slash command'lar, bu hafta
#swift :personal >1k → personal namespace'te büyük swift skill'leri
/t ~t recall → bugün değişen text skill'leri, "recall" içeren